[Issue 14387] Disallow string literals as assert conditions

2024-01-26 Thread d-bugmail--- via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 Nick Treleaven changed: What|Removed |Added CC||temta...@gmail.com --- Comment #7 from

[Issue 14387] Disallow string literals as assert conditions

2023-12-29 Thread d-bugmail--- via Digitalmars-d-bugs
|--- |FIXED --- Comment #6 from Dlang Bot --- dlang/dmd pull request #15860 "Deprecate string literals as (static) assert conditions" was merged into master: - 55d0483a5d5ceef59327cde7cb12124d98547459 by Nick Treleaven: Deprecate string literals as assert conditions Fix I

[Issue 14387] Disallow string literals as assert conditions

2023-11-24 Thread d-bugmail--- via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 --- Comment #5 from Dlang Bot --- @ntrel created dlang/dmd pull request #15860 "Deprecate string literals as (static) assert conditions" fixing this issue: - Deprecate string literals as assert conditions Fix Issue 14387 - Disal

[Issue 14387] Disallow string literals as assert conditions

2023-11-20 Thread d-bugmail--- via Digitalmars-d-bugs
created dlang/dmd pull request #15837 "Deprecate boolean evaluation of array/string literals" fixing this issue: - Deprecate boolean evaluation of array/string literals Fix Issue 14387 - Disallow string literals as assert conditions. https://github.com/dlang/dmd/pull/15837 --

[Issue 14387] Disallow string literals as assert conditions

2022-12-17 Thread d-bugmail--- via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 Iain Buclaw changed: What|Removed |Added Priority|P1 |P4 --

[Issue 14387] Disallow string literals as assert conditions

2022-12-04 Thread d-bugmail--- via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 Nick Treleaven changed: What|Removed |Added CC||n...@geany.org --- Comment #3 from Nick

[Issue 14387] Disallow string literals as assert conditions

2015-04-04 Thread via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 Vladimir Panteleev thecybersha...@gmail.com changed: What|Removed |Added CC|

[Issue 14387] Disallow string literals as assert conditions

2015-04-02 Thread via Digitalmars-d-bugs
https://issues.dlang.org/show_bug.cgi?id=14387 --- Comment #1 from Don clugd...@yahoo.com.au --- The spec says: As a debugging tool, the compiler may insert checks to verify that the condition indeed holds by evaluating AssignExpression at runtime. If it evaluates to a non-null class reference,